Symbiosis SET 2026 Eligibility Criteria: Do You Qualify? ๐
You need to be sure that you meet the eligibility requirements for the program youโre interested in before hitting the โapplyโ button. Hereโs the breakdown for you:
For B.Tech Courses ๐ทโโ๏ธ:
- Qualification: You must have passed 12th grade (or its equivalent) from a recognized board. Simple enough, right?
- Marks: You need a minimum of 45% marks (40% for SC/ST) in the qualifying exam. So, make sure your grades are on point! ๐
- Subjects: Physics and Mathematics should be your compulsory subjects, and you can pick Chemistry, Biotechnology, Biology, or Technical Vocational as the third subject. So, get ready to juggle numbers and formulas! ๐ข
For BBA Courses ๐:
- Qualification: Must have completed 12th grade from a recognized board.
- Marks: Minimum of 50% marks (45% for SC/ST/PWD).
- Subjects: No special subject requirements, just your basic high school subjects.
For BA LLB / BA LLB (Hons.) โ๏ธ:
- Qualification: You must have completed 12th grade or its equivalent exam.
- Marks: A minimum of 45% marks (40% for SC/ST students).
- Appearing Candidates: If youโre currently in your 12th grade and will be appearing for the exams in 2026, youโre eligible to apply. So, no worries if you havenโt got your final results yet! ๐
Symbiosis SET 2026 Exam Pattern: The Inside Scoop ๐
Now that youโve registered, itโs time to get into the exam specifics! Knowing the exam pattern is crucial to being fully prepared. Hereโs everything you need to know:
SET (For Engineering, Design, and other UG courses) ๐ง๐จ:
- Mode: Online (Goodbye, pens and papers! ๐)
- Duration: 1 hour of pure focus. ๐
- Question Type: Multiple Choice Questions (MCQs), no surprises here! โ๏ธ
- Total Questions: 60 questions.
- Marks per Question: Each question is worth 1 mark.
Section-wise Breakdown:
- General Awareness: 16 questions ๐ฐ
- General English: 16 questions ๐
- Analytical & Logical Reasoning: 12 questions ๐ง
- Quantitative Aptitude: 16 questions ๐ข
SLAT (For Law Courses) โ๏ธ:
- Mode: Online.
- Total Questions: 60 questions.
- Marks per Question: 1 mark for each.
Section-wise Breakdown:
- Logical Reasoning: 12 questions ๐งฉ
- Legal Reasoning: 12 questions โ๏ธ
- Analytical Reasoning: 12 questions ๐ง
- Reading Comprehension: 12 questions ๐
- General Knowledge: 12 questions ๐
SITEEE (For Engineering) ๐ฌ:
- Mode: Online.
- Total Questions: 60 questions.
- Marks per Question: 2 marks per question.
Section-wise Breakdown:
- Physics: 15 questions ๐๏ธโโ๏ธ
- Chemistry: 15 questions ๐งช
- Mathematics: 30 questions โ
